About N-[2-(3,4-dihydro-1H-isoquinolin-2-yl)ethyl]-2-oxo-1H-quinoline-6-sulfonamide
N-[2-(3,4-dihydro-1H-isoquinolin-2-yl)ethyl]-2-oxo-1H-quinoline-6-sulfonamide (PubChem CID 46361480) has the molecular formula C20H21N3O3S
and a molecular weight of 383.47 g/mol. Its IUPAC name is N-[2-(3,4-dihydro-1H-isoquinolin-2-yl)ethyl]-2-oxo-1H-quinoline-6-sulfonamide.

What is the SMILES notation for N-[2-(3,4-dihydro-1H-isoquinolin-2-yl)ethyl]-2-oxo-1H-quinoline-6-sulfonamide?
The canonical SMILES for N-[2-(3,4-dihydro-1H-isoquinolin-2-yl)ethyl]-2-oxo-1H-quinoline-6-sulfonamide is O=c1ccc2cc(S(=O)(=O)NCCN3CCc4ccccc4C3)ccc2[nH]1.
What is the InChIKey of N-[2-(3,4-dihydro-1H-isoquinolin-2-yl)ethyl]-2-oxo-1H-quinoline-6-sulfonamide?
The InChIKey is PBEWUQHXGOXKFT-UHFFFAOYSA-N. The full InChI is InChI=1S/C20H21N3O3S/c24-20-8-5-16-13-18(6-7-19(16)22-20)27(25,26)21-10-12-23-11-9-15-3-1-2-4-17(15)14-23/h1-8,13,21H,9-12,14H2,(H,22,24).
What are the key properties of N-[2-(3,4-dihydro-1H-isoquinolin-2-yl)ethyl]-2-oxo-1H-quinoline-6-sulfonamide?
N-[2-(3,4-dihydro-1H-isoquinolin-2-yl)ethyl]-2-oxo-1H-quinoline-6-sulfonamide has a molecular weight of 383.47 g/mol, XLogP of 1.86, 5 rotatable bonds, 2 hydrogen bond donors, and 4 hydrogen bond acceptors.
